Re: Vision eligibility in SI (technical) Post?
The requirement for SI (Technical) Post is that candidates must have vision Eye-sight (with or without glasses) 6/6 in one eye and 6/9 in the other for distance vision. 0.6 in one eye and 0.8 in the other for near vision.
